The Los Angeles Lakers are preparing for a critical road matchup against the New Orleans Pelicans following a disappointing loss to the Oklahoma City Thunder. Austin Reaves, who has been recognized as the team's most pivotal player, expressed a blunt assessment of the Lakers' performance in that game, emphasizing the need for improvement.

According to ESPN, Reaves is expected to earn a substantial raise in the upcoming offseason, highlighting his growing importance to the team. The Lakers are also dealing with injury concerns, as LeBron James is listed as out with right sciatica, and Gabe Vincent is sidelined due to a left ankle sprain, which raises questions about their depth heading into the next game.

Additionally, the Lakers have added former first-round pick Kobe Bufkin to their South Bay Lakers, demonstrating their commitment to scouting and developing talent. This move may also indicate a strategic shift as the team looks to bolster its roster amidst current challenges.

Meanwhile, speculation around potential trade targets is growing, with reports suggesting that Naji Marshall could be a viable option for the Lakers if the Mavericks are willing to engage in discussions.

As the Lakers prepare for the Pelicans, they carry the weight of needing a bounce-back performance to regain momentum in the season, especially after a rough start against the Thunder, where they were blown out.

The upcoming game not only serves as a test of their resilience but is also an opportunity to assess the contributions of their newer players, including Dalton Knecht, who is seeking to establish himself further within the squad.

Overall, the Lakers are at a critical juncture, balancing injury recovery, player development, and the pursuit of improvement as they navigate through the early part of the season.
